Toshiaki Maki (🦋 @ik.am)
36.4K posts

Toshiaki Maki (🦋 @ik.am)
@making
Senior Principal Architect at @VMwareTanzu / @Broadcom | Ex @Pivotal | Bichon Frise 🍋🐩
Tokyo, Japan Sumali Nisan 2007
189 Sinusundan3.7K Mga Tagasunod
Toshiaki Maki (🦋 @ik.am) nag-retweet
Toshiaki Maki (🦋 @ik.am) nag-retweet

Spring AI 2.0.0-M3, 1.1.3 and 1.0.4 are released. 2.0 M3 brings Anthropic SDK, MCP enhancements, Jackson 3 updates, Vector Stores, ToolCallAdvisor and security improvements Find more on the releases here: spring.io/blog/2026/03/1…
English
Toshiaki Maki (🦋 @ik.am) nag-retweet

🚀 Datasource Micrometer v1.4.0 & v2.2.0 are now on Maven Central!
Highlights
• SPRING_PROXY is now the default proxy strategy
• Proper support for Spring Cloud refresh scope with HikariCP
Release Notes
github.com/jdbc-observati…
#springboot #micrometer #observability #jdbc
English

Spring Batch 6で、JobParametersIncrementerを使っていた時の挙動が変わっていた。
Incrementerを使った場合は自分で指定したパラメータは無視されるようになった。
今までジョブの繰り返し実行でエラーにならないように闇雲にRunIdIncrementerを設定してたけど、誤用だと。
github.com/spring-project…
日本語

github.com/making/otel-lo…
otel-logs-autoconfigure log4j2に対応しました
日本語
Toshiaki Maki (🦋 @ik.am) nag-retweet

Spring Boot 4.0 + OpenTelemetry の件をブログに書きました。
先日の #jjug で「話さなかった」部分をしっかりめに書いています。
Spring Boot 4.0 の OpenTelemetry 対応がほぼ理想的になった件。 - 谷本 心 in せろ部屋
cero-t.hatenadiary.jp/entry/2026/03/…
日本語
Toshiaki Maki (🦋 @ik.am) nag-retweet

Nullability Maven Plugin で Maven ユーザーが JSpecify/NullAway を使いやすくする ik.am/entries/900
日本語

management.opentelemetry.instrumentation.logback-appender.capture-key-value-pair-attributes=trueにすれば、SLF4Jのkey-value APIで追加したpairがOtelのAttributesに変換されて便利。構造化ログなんていらんかったんや
logger.atInfo()
.addKeyValue("a", a)
.addKeyValue("b", b)
.log("..")
谷本 心 (Shin Tanimoto)@cero_t
Spring Boot 4.0 + OpenTelemetry の件をブログに書きました。 先日の #jjug で「話さなかった」部分をしっかりめに書いています。 Spring Boot 4.0 の OpenTelemetry 対応がほぼ理想的になった件。 - 谷本 心 in せろ部屋 cero-t.hatenadiary.jp/entry/2026/03/…
日本語

Spring SecurityのPasskeys対応をSpring Session JDBCと一緒に使うには
github.com/spring-project…
が必要だった(7.1.0-SNAPSHOT)
日本語

Rustやるぞ、まずは自分用にCLI作ってみよう。
「Claude、やって」→「できました」
できた...何も身についてない...
っていうのを何度も繰り返している
谷本 心 (Shin Tanimoto)@cero_t
ちょこっと作りたい小さなWebアプリがあったので、片手間にAIに作らせ、またAIから「小さなアプリなら fly.io で公開すれば無料だよ」と教わり、言われるがままに公開してみた。 アウトプットの早さには驚くんだけど、1ミリも自分の勉強になってない感は凄い。
日本語
Toshiaki Maki (🦋 @ik.am) nag-retweet

Spring Framework 7.0.5及び7.0.6による性能改善の効果。
あと、readOnlyな@ TransactionalにちゃんとreadOnly = trueをつけることも大事。
spring.io/blog/2026/02/2…

Toshiaki Maki (🦋 @ik.am)@making
Spring Framework 7.0.5 (Spring Boot 4.0.3)は上げるだけでSpring MVCのパフォーマンスが改善するはずなので、アップデート推奨です github.com/spring-project…
日本語
Toshiaki Maki (🦋 @ik.am) nag-retweet

some simple tweaks transaction management and refinements in the latest version of Spring Framework can make for some very good results in scalability
Dr. David Syer has the details and analysis here
spring.io/blog/2026/02/2…
English

Spring Boot 2.7のLTS、もう2.7.31まで来てるのかぁ。
enterprise.spring.io/projects/sprin…
日本語



